F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E August 12, 2015 USA Junior near perfect at WBSC Junior Womenâs World Championship; Barnhill throws perfect game while Conley picks up no-hitter OKLAHOMA CITY â The USA Softball Junior Womenâs National Team cruised at the 2015 World Baseball Softball Confederation (WBSC) Junior Womenâs World Championship (JWWC) today in Oklahoma City, Okla. at the ASA Hall of Fame Complex. Team USA secured another two wins and finished undefeated in the preliminary rounds as the pitching staff dominated from the circle. In game one, Kelly Barnhill (Marietta, Ga.) was flawless from the circle as she collected a perfect game in a 16-0 (three inning) win over Mexico while Zoe Conley (Berkeley, Calif.) issued a no-hitter in Team USAâs 7-0 (five inning) win over the Czech Republic. USA 16, Mexico 0 (three innings) Team USA continued their strong performance at the WBSSSC JWWC today at OGE Energy Field in their first game of the day against Mexico. Team USA came out firing in the first inning as Alyssa Palomino (Mission Viejo, Calif.) brought in two RBI to set the pace as her hot streak continues at the JWWC. Kelly Barnhill (Marietta, Ga.) showed off her full arsenal of pitches as she continued to stifle batters en route to a no-hitter. The game ended via run rule courtesy of Palominoâs grand slam in the top of the third inning. âEverything is a lot easier when you have great pitching and Kelly was on today,â said Tairia Flowers (Tucson, Ariz.), Head Coach of the USA Softball Junior Womenâs National Team. âOur teamâs mindset is really good right now. Alyssaâs hitting is very solid and we hope that she can continue that into the playoffs.â Palomino went a perfect 3-for-3 at the plate, brought in six RBI and scored three times. âIt felt good,â said Palomino. âIâve been in a good rhythm here at the Junior Worlds and just have been trying to make plays for our team.â It took only three innings for Barnhill to notch the win, as she allowed no hits and struck out six. Samantha Urbina took the loss for Mexico, as she lasted only two innings and gave up eight earned runs. USA 7, Czech Republic 0 (five innings) Team USA once again came out strong in the first inning and rolled to a 7-0 win over Czech Republic in their final game of the preliminary rounds. Czech Republic batters were not able to locate Zoe Conleyâs (Berkeley, Calif.) pitches all game as Conley threw a no-hitter, striking out 10 batters in five innings of work. A couple of big two-run home runs by Jenna Lilley (North Canton, Ohio) and Madilyn Nickles (Merced, Calif.) in the first got Team USA out front early. Czech Republic was never able to recover after Team USAâs explosive first inning. âAnother nice win for us tonight,â said Flowers. âWe made some solid plays defensively that helped out Zoe. Weâre glad to come out on top of our pool, but we know that there is still a lot of work to do to reach our ultimate goal at this Championship. Weâve got what it takes to get the Gold, itâs just up to us to come together during the playoffs and make it happen.â McKenna Arriola (West Hills, Calif.), Sydney Romero (Temecula, Calif.) and DJ Sanders (Columbus, Miss.) each brought runs in for Team USA. âI was in a good rhythm,â said Conley. âItâs definitely a big confidence booster for me to come out and be successful like I was tonight. Our team is excited to start the playoff rounds to prove what weâre made of.â In total, Team USA has outscored teams 82-3 and improved their record to 7-0 to finish pool play. About ASA/USA Softball About the World Baseball Softball Confederation Headquartered in the Olympic Capital city of Lausanne, Switzerland, the World Baseball Softball Confederation (WBSC) was established in April 2013 and granted recognition as the sole competent authority in baseball and softball by the International Olympic Committee at the 125th IOC Session in September 2013. The WBSC represents a united baseball/softball sports movement that encompasses over 65 million athletes worldwide. The WBSC governs all international competitions involving any of the National Teams of its 141 National Federation members. The WBSC oversees the Softball World Championships, The Premier 12, the World Baseball Classic, and the U12, U15, U18, U21 and Women's Baseball World Cups.
